Moderna, a biotechnology company, has announced promising results from a Phase 3 clinical trial of its mRNA vaccine for treating advanced-stage melanoma, the deadliest form of skin cancer. The trial, which involved over 1,100 patients, showed that the vaccine led to a statistically significant and clinically meaningful improvement in preventing melanoma recurrence or spread. This breakthrough could potentially revolutionize the treatment of melanoma, and Moderna's stock price surged by more than double on Wednesday morning after the news was announced. The vaccine works by using artificial intelligence to identify specific mutations in each patient's tumor and then delivering synthetic mRNA into cells to attack those mutations. This is a major milestone for mRNA vaccines, which have shown significant promise in treating various types of cancer, including melanoma.
